DISCRETE MANUFACTURING ERP MARKET OVERVIEW
The global Discrete Manufacturing ERP Market is starting at an estimated value of USD 7.13 Billion in 2026, ultimately reaching USD 15.13 Billion by 2035. This growth reflects a steady CAGR of 8.8% from 2026 through 2035.

By Type
Based on type; the market is divided into On Premise ERP and Cloud-Based ERP
- On‑Premise ERP: On‑premise ERP systems account for a significant portion of the discrete manufacturing ERP market, with approximately 39%–48% of total ERP installations deployed on‑site, especially in larger and highly regulated manufacturing environments where control and customization are priorities. These systems are traditionally installed on a company’s own servers and infrastructure, offering direct control over data, security, and performance, which is why over 41% of large‑scale manufacturers in sectors like automotive, aerospace, and defense prefer this model for mission‑critical operations. On‑premise ERP solutions typically require substantial upfront investment in hardware, software licenses, and internal IT personnel, and they often involve longer implementation cycles than cloud alternatives. Approximately 35%–45% of manufacturers cite integration complexity with legacy systems and high maintenance costs as primary challenges with on‑premise deployments. However, these systems remain essential for firms with strict compliance requirements and deep legacy integrations, and many manufacturers continue to invest in them as part of hybrid strategies.
- Cloud‑Based ERP: Cloud‑based ERP systems represent the leading deployment type in the discrete manufacturing ERP market, accounting for around 52%–61% of installations, with the trend continuing to shift toward cloud solutions due to scalability, lower upfront costs, and ease of remote access. Cloud ERP is typically delivered via subscription and hosted by the vendor or a third‑party cloud provider, reducing the need for extensive on‑site IT infrastructure and shifting maintenance responsibilities externally. These systems offer faster deployment, seamless updates, and integration with modern technologies like IoT and AI, which has driven adoption particularly among mid‑sized manufacturers and companies with multiple facilities. Cloud ERP also enhances operational efficiency and real‑time data visibility, making it appealing for manufacturers seeking agile digital transformation. Adoption has increased rapidly, with newer installations increasingly favoring cloud platforms over traditional on‑premise deployments. Despite concerns around data sovereignty and recurring subscription costs, cloud‑based ERP’s flexibility and reduced infrastructure burden make it the preferred choice for a growing majority of discrete manufacturers.
